Mental health and well-being are critical issues that affect people all around the world, including in Tanzania. Despite the significant impact of mental health challenges on individuals, families, and communities, mental health services and resources are often limited or inaccessible in many parts of Tanzania.
In Tanzania, like many other low-income countries, there is a significant shortage of mental health professionals and a lack of investment in mental health services. This shortage is particularly acute in rural areas, where access to mental health services is extremely limited.
As a result, many people in Tanzania who are struggling with mental health challenges are unable to access the care and support they need to manage their symptoms and improve their well-being. This can have serious consequences for their quality of life, as well as for their families and communities.

By developing a chatbot-based solution that leverages AI and natural language processing, we hope to create a scalable and accessible support system that can help individuals in Tanzania manage their mental health challenges and improve their well-being. By providing personalized support and resources through a chatbot that can be accessed from anywhere with an internet connection. By doing so, we believe we can make a meaningful impact on the mental health and well-being of individuals in our local community, and help to reduce the social and economic costs of mental health challenges in Tanzania.
